Peace and good hunting to all,

New to muzzle,

Using the pyrodex pellets, should I use 2 or 3 to start out?

2 pellets for me also -100 grains thats shooting 250 grain sabot
dont think much more is needed but heck try the 3 pellets i guess ,my buddies gun shoots 3 pellets better i guess just get out to the range and have fun with that gun and see what work for you:thumbsup:

i too have the blackdiamond and use the powerbelts with 100 grains, the only thing i do before i go out is fowl the barrell with about 50 grains of ffg powder in my garage (wear hearing protection) i find my BD50 shoots better with this practice.
